没有合适的资源?快使用搜索试试~ 我知道了~
Android sdl环境配置与编译1
需积分: 0 1 下载量 26 浏览量
2022-08-08
17:47:40
上传
评论
收藏 25KB DOCX 举报
温馨提示
试读
2页
第二步:解压完成后进入ndk路径/build/tool/,开始配置环境,使用命令:sudo ./make-standalone-toolchain.sh -
资源推荐
资源详情
资源评论
开发环境配置
一、 Linux 开发环境配置
如果是新安装的 linux 系统,下面的工具都需要安装。后面的所有指令都有 sudo
表示使用 root 权限执行指令。
1、 sudo apt-get install doxygen mscgen lmodern
2、 sudo apt-get install python
3、 sudo apt-get install gcc
4、 sudo apt-get install g++
5、 sudo apt-get install cmake
二、 Android NDK
集成了 android 交叉编译器,针对不同版本 android 平台提供了相应的 gcc、g++、
ndk-build、ndk-gdb 等一系列编译和调试工具。
安装 ndk:
官网下载地址:
https://dl.google.com/android/repository/android-ndk-r10e-linux-x86.zip
安装包选择:
选择安装包需要注意几点:
1、 ndk 应该选择 32 位,目前 android 系统基本都是 32 位系统
2、 ndk host 系统应该与 linux 系统一致,比如 linux 是 32 位的,那么 ndk host 系统
选择也是 32 位
安装步骤:
第一步:解压安装包,一般放到 linux home 目录,不要放共享目录。
第二步:解压完成后进入 ndk 路径/build/tool/,开始配置环境,使用命令:
sudo ./make-standalone-toolchain.sh --platform=android-18 --ndk-dir=/home/ndk/ --i
nstall-dir=/opt/android-18-toolchain/ --toolchain=arm-linux-androideabi-4.6
说明:
platform: 进入 ndk dir/platforms/ 下可以看到有很多以 android-n 这种格式命名的
文件夹。platform 的参数只能从这里面选择一个。
下表是 android API 级别与 android 版本的对应关系
API
level
22
19
18
17
16
15
14
13
12
11
10
9
8
And
roid
版
本
5.0
4.4
4.3
4.2
4.1
4.03,
4.04
4.0.
0~4.
02
3.2
3.1.x
3.0.x
2.3.
3 ,
2.3.
4
2.3.
0~2.
3.2
2.2.x
ndk-dir:ndk 的目录,就是刚刚解压的目录。
install-dir: ndk 安装目录,一般选择 opt 下面。
tool-chain: 工具链,在 ndk dir/toolchains/ 下面可以看到很多文件夹,每个文件夹
对应一种工具链,我们选择的只能是 arm-linux-androideabi 为前缀的文件夹,其他的都
资源评论
郭逗
- 粉丝: 30
- 资源: 318
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功